Filter results 169 Cars
Browse by shape
Browse by engine
Sort By
2019 BMW X3
xDrive20i M Sport 5dr Step Auto
xDrive20i M Sport 5dr Step Auto
Motorpoint Chingford - 105 miles away
25,258 miles
Request callback
£26,599
2022 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Marshall Volkswagen Loughton - 107 miles away
21,585 miles
Request callback
£34,920
2016 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Vertu Honda Stockton - 108 miles away
70,401 miles
Request callback
£15,999
2018 BMW X3
xDrive30d M Sport 5dr Step Auto
xDrive30d M Sport 5dr Step Auto
Anchor Cars - 108 miles away
77,000 miles
Request callback
£22,895
2019 BMW X3
xDrive20d M Sport 5dr Step Auto
xDrive20d M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
56,193 miles
Request callback
£23,750
2020 BMW X3
xDrive20i xLine 5dr Step Auto
xDrive20i xLine 5dr Step Auto
Saxton 4X4 - 111 miles away
28,622 miles
Request callback
£25,500
2022 BMW X3
xDrive20i MHT xLine 5dr Step Auto
xDrive20i MHT xLine 5dr Step Auto
Saxton 4X4 - 111 miles away
9,542 miles
Request callback
£35,500
2022 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
11,610 miles
Request callback
£36,150
2022 BMW X3
xDrive20i MHT M Sport 5dr Step Auto
xDrive20i MHT M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
16,330 miles
Request callback
£37,200
2023 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Saxton 4X4 - 111 miles away
32,109 miles
Request callback
£37,700
2023 BMW X3
xDrive 30e M Sport 5dr Auto
xDrive 30e M Sport 5dr Auto
Saxton 4X4 - 111 miles away
25,376 miles
Request callback
£38,400
2023 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
8,311 miles
Request callback
£40,200
2023 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
7,560 miles
Request callback
£41,800
2024 BMW X3
xDrive20d MHT M Sport 5dr Step Auto
xDrive20d MHT M Sport 5dr Step Auto
Saxton 4X4 - 111 miles away
4,042 miles
Request callback
£46,750
Buy new from | £45,508 | (list price from £50,185) |
Showing 76 - 90 of 169 cars